FRA: Provisional tables for theatre cheques posted

Share

On Monday, November 7, 2022, the provisional lists of Beneficiaries, Excluded Persons and Theatre Companies - Providers for the Theatre Voucher Grant Programme of the Public Employment Service(DYPA) for the 2022/23 winter season.

Objections to the results will be submitted exclusively online from Tuesday 8 November at 10:00 until Thursday 10 November at 15:00. Objections can be submitted via the Single Digital Portal of the Public Administration (gov.gr) at the following addresses:

For beneficiary objections:

Specifically, the route is: Home - Work and Insurance - Compensation and Benefits - Entertainment Cheques.

For provider objections:

Specifically, the route is: Home - Employment and Insurance - Compensation and Benefits - Entertainment Cheque Providers

Objections not submitted electronically will not be considered.

Beneficiaries lodging an objection must:

  • have first checked whether they themselves are responsible for the incorrect result due to incorrect completion of the application form by referring to it with their system passwords
  • check from the relevant list whether they have any excluded beneficiary members
  • state the reasons for the objection (e.g. failure to issue a cheque for a beneficiary child)
  • substantiate their claims by attaching by electronic scan all the required supporting documents, in accordance with the Public Call

Providers filing an electronic objection must substantiate their claims by attaching to their objection by electronic scanning supporting documents evidencing their claims.

The aim of the programme is to support the intellectual development of the workforce and support theatre companies. Providers participate in the scheme by offering a specific number of plaza seats to attend performances that will be staged in their theatres during the 2022/23 winter season.

With the cheque, beneficiaries can attend the theatrical performance of their choice from the NYPA's Register of Providers, without paying any additional amount. The value of the cheques is limited to a maximum of 15 euros for the main stage. For the children's stages the value of the cheques is 12 euros.

The programme will start the day after the publication of the final results and will run throughout the winter theatre season 2022/23 with an end date of 31.05.2023.

The total budget amounts to €3.000.000.
